Immigrants from Europe vs Immigrants from Malaysia Family Households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 546,902,993 people shows a moderate posit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Europe and percentage of family households in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.436 and weighted average of 63.7%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 197,925,894 people shows a mild negative corre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Malaysia and percentage of family households in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.304 and weighted average of 64.0%, a difference of 0.40%.
